Ed Davis
Painter/Cartoonist
         

Born in California, Ed Davis served in the Army then settled in Texas to work at NASA and pursue a degree in Graphic Arts. He built a 35 year career and professional reputation as a Graphic Arts leader in Houston, broken only by periods of work in Europe and the Middle East. He has been an active cartoonist and painter since 1961 and moved to Shelby in 1999 to concentrate exclusively on these creative pursuits.

Ed's creations appeal to a variety of individuals and commercial markets. Magazines, newspapers, greeting cards, marketing, and advertising are his major cartoon outlets while his paintings are in private collections in California, Texas, Nevada, Oregon, Idaho, North Carolina, and Utah. He collaborated on a children's book when he illustrated “Ham & Eggs”...as yet unpublished.

Influenced by his love for travel, country music, sports, and his Christian faith, Ed tends to produce an off-beat brand of humor with international, redneck, thought provoking appeal. His paintings demonstrate his love for color, texture, and faith. He works primarily in acrylic and pen and ink on a variety of surfaces. Ed taught graphics as a substitute at the Houston Community College.
